In an Investor State Dispute (ISD) lawsuit filed against the Korean government by Iranian electronics firm Entekhab Group, an international court has ruled that the Korean government’s involvement in the sale of Daewoo Electronics was unfair, ordering the state to reimburse the Iranian firm 73 billion won (US$67.96 million). Entekhab Group filed a suit with the United Nations Commission on International Trade Law in Sept. 2017 on the grounds that Seoul violated the bilateral investment treaty during Entekhab’s 2010 takeover of Daewoo Electronics. The ISD litigation system allows foreign investors to file for compensation if a state government has acted in a way that makes an investor incur unnecessary losses.
